How do religious women feel about the birth control mandate? Pretty OK, actually.
A University of Michigan study says that support for religion and birth control actually can mix when it comes to the Affordable Care Act’s (Obamacare) birth control mandate. In fact, the proportion of Protestant and Catholic women who believe employers should cover contraception are similar — 66 percent and 63 percent, respectively. And although my …
